人工智能大模型的开发流程通常包括以下几个关键步骤:
1. 需求分析与规划:
- 确定项目的目标和预期成果。
- 分析目标用户群体的需求,定义模型需要解决的具体问题。
- 制定详细的项目计划和时间表。
2. 数据准备:
- 收集和整理相关领域的大量数据,这些数据将用于训练模型。
- 确保数据的质量,包括清洗、标注和验证数据的准确性。
- 对数据进行预处理,如归一化、标准化等,以便模型更好地学习。
3. 模型设计:
- 根据问题的性质选择合适的算法和架构。
- 设计模型的参数和结构,确保它们能够有效地捕捉数据中的模式和特征。
- 考虑模型的可扩展性和可解释性,以便于后续的维护和优化。
4. 模型训练:
- 使用准备好的数据对模型进行训练。
- 调整模型的超参数,以获得最佳性能。
- 监控训练过程中的性能指标,如准确率、损失函数等。
5. 模型评估与调优:
- 使用独立的测试数据集对模型进行评估,确保其泛化能力。
- 根据评估结果对模型进行调整和优化,以提高性能。
- 可能需要多次迭代才能达到满意的效果。
6. 模型部署与应用:
- 将训练好的模型部署到生产环境中,使其能够实时处理请求。
- 集成模型到现有的系统中,确保与其他组件的兼容性。
- 提供用户界面或API,使用户能够方便地使用模型。
7. 持续优化与更新:
- 定期收集用户反馈和系统日志,了解模型在实际使用中的表现。
- 根据新的数据和技术进步,不断更新和优化模型。
- 保持对行业动态的关注,以便及时调整模型以适应新的需求。
在整个开发流程中,团队需要密切合作,确保各个环节顺利进行。同时,还需要关注伦理和隐私问题,确保在开发和使用模型时遵循相关法律法规。